2. Have A Quality Conversation With Your Spouse

Since you are about to begin a new inning of your life with your future spouse, it is important that you have a quality conversation with him/her. Before tying the knot, you need to know each other so that you are well aware of each other’s likes, dislikes, vulnerabilities, etc. Unless you don’t communicate with each other, you won’t be able to know if you are suitable for each other. Moreover, this will help you in developing a strong bond with each other.

7. Spend Some Time With Him/Her

Who said you can spend time with your spouse only after you have tied the knot? Gone are the days when people used to know their spouses after getting married. You can certainly spend some quality time together before tying the knot. For this, you can go on dates to know each other in a better way. You can also try to visit each other on some special occasions such as birthdays, festivals, etc. This way you will not only become familiar to each other but will also develop a strong bond.

9. Travel With Your Would Be Spouse

Going on a honeymoon with your spouse after tying the knot is quite romantic and cool. But how about going on a trip with your spouse before marriage? At first, you may feel a bit shy and hesitant about going on a trip with him/her but then you need to think that this could be a golden opportunity to get to know each other. You will be exposed to each other’s behaviour and vulnerabilities. This will further help you in deciding how things will go post marriage.

The major intention of doing these things before getting married is to find out if you are happy with your marriage.
